Wild bird mix?

Have 5 acres of WB feed to sow, only 6 KGS/ acre. No one wants to be bothered sowing it with a modern machine, and I don't think a Massey 30 drill would put such a small amount on. It has been suggested that if I mix the seed with 1 cwt of fertiliser and just broadcast it. Has anyone done this and how did it turn out?

If it small seeds it will work well, try and do it ahead of some rain.

Do you know anyone with a small electric broadcaster usually used for slug pellets.

I have a modern drill, but will still broadcast the small seeds.

If we put a mustard cover crop in, we mix some in the fertiliser spreader and spin it on. Before rain does help. Depending on conditions then it'll get lightly harrowed once. Generally comes up thick as you like.
